Psychometric performance of the 6th version of the Addiction Severity Index in Spanish (ASI-6) This work analysed the psychometric properties of the 6th version of the Addiction Severity Index (ASI-6) translated and adapted to the Spanish language. A multicentre, observational and prospective design was used. A total of 258 participants were included, 217 were patients (35 stable patients and 182 unstable patients), and 41 were controls. The results show satisfactory psychometric performance of the ASI-6. The degree of the internal consistency of the standardized objective scores ranged between 47 and 95. As for test-retest reliability, the values were acceptable, varying from.36 to 1. The study of the internal structure revealed a good lit to a unidimensional solution for all scales taken independently. Regarding convergent-discriminant validity, the correlations between the primary and secondary scales of the AS1-6 and the Clinic Global Impression score were low, with values from.01 to.26. Likewise, 8 of the 15 scales differentiated between controls and unstable patients. The psychometric properties of the AS1-6 Spanish version seem to be acceptable, though it is necessary to carry out new studies to test metric quality with independent samples of patients.
